Happy St. Patrick’s Day!

I couldn’t let the day pass by without wishing all of you a happy St. Patrick’s Day. I have many happy memories of St. Patrick’s Day and a couple of trips I’ve taken to Ireland. When I was in seventh grade at Holy Name of Mary School in Valley Stream, NY the band marched in the St. Patrick’s Day Parade in New York City. I played the glockenspiel and was very excited to see a cousin wave to me from the sidewalk. The fact that we were the last band and just ahead of the street sweeper doesn’t diminish this happy memory!

Of course, in college St. Patrick’s Day was a non-authorized day off spent drinking green beer, dancing, and spending time with friends.

And, I’ve been fortunate enough to travel to Ireland twice, both times kissing the Blarney Stone. I have a photo of me and my Mom standing by the Carragh River. We figured that was as close as we were going to get to a landmark with our surname!
